The 15th century Rectors Palace, was the administrative centre of the Dubrovnik Republic. Its style is Gothic, with the Renaissance and Baroque reconstructions. Today it houses the Cultural-historic Department of the Dubrovnik Museum. The exhibition halls display the original setting with antique furniture and objects for daily use, as well as paintings by local and Italian masters. 

In addition, the Museum also displays a collection of old coins from the Dubrovnik Republic, a collection of arms and utensils of Domus Christi Pharmacy from the 15th century.

With its excellent acoustics, the palace is often used as a concert venue.
